Advertisement

Steve Ray Foster

Advertisement

Steve Ray Foster

Birth
Eden, Rockingham County, North Carolina, USA
Death
1 Apr 1989 (aged 31)
Palm Beach County, Florida, USA
Burial
Eden, Rockingham County, North Carolina, USA Add to Map
Memorial ID
View Source